Early Computer Projection Ranks UNC Basketball In Top 10


What do computer rankings say about the prospects for the UNC men’s basketball team? Bart Torvik, whose rankings are one of the most respected computer rankings, has the Tar Heels moving up from No. 9 in last season’s final ranking to No. 6 in his 2024-25 preseason projection. The Tar Heels and Duke (No. 2) are the only ACC teams in his top 20. (Tar Heel Tribune)
